The Early Days: A One-Size-Fits-All Approach

In the initial stages of eyewear design, the focus was largely on functionality, with little consideration for the varying sizes and shapes of people’s heads. Eyewear manufacturers adopted a one-size-fits-all approach that, unsurprisingly, did not actually fit all. Those with larger head sizes often had to settle for ill-fitting frames that could lead to discomfort, headaches, and a less-than-ideal appearance. The limited options available forced many to choose glasses that were purely functional, overlooking personal style preferences.

The Role of Technology and Design Innovation

Advancements in technology and design have played a pivotal role in the evolution of plus-size eyewear. Materials like TR90, known for its lightweight and flexible properties, along with durable and adaptable elements like β-titanium and carbon fiber, have allowed for the creation of frames that are both comfortable for larger head sizes and fashion-forward. These materials have also made it possible to produce a wider variety of styles, ensuring that plus-size glasses are no longer limited to basic designs.
